Note 1. The electrical characteristics are measured after allowing the device to stabilize for 90 seconds
with +30°C lead temperature.
Note 2. Test conditions for temperature coefficient are as follows:
a.Izt = 7.5mA, T1 = +25°C, T2 = +125°C (NTE5000A thru NTE5021A)
b.Izt = Rated Izt, T1 = +25°C, T2 = +125°C (NTE5022A thru NTE5060A)
Device to be temperature stabilized with current applied prior to reading breakdown voltage
at the specified ambient temperature.
